    By the way, one reason why one doesn't hear about "court packing" plans from the GOP is that they have successfully weaponised their control of the Senate so as to achieve the same goals without taking the political heat for such a "radical" measure.

    By denying and delaying appointments by Democratic presidents and ramming through their own choices, they have been able to have a much greater influence on the composition of the courts than was previously thought possible.
